ACOM 4312 - Intercultural Communication


Three credit hours.

An exploration of the relationship between communication and varied ethnic and national cultures across multiple contexts, including work, community, medical, and interpersonal. Topics such as culture shock, language, conflict, and cultural identity arc explored. Class activities and case studies focused on developing competent and ethical application of major intercultural theories and concepts. Dual listed in the Graduate Catalog as ACOM 5312.

Prerequisites: ACOM 1300  or declared major/minor in International Studies or consent of the instructor.
